Worum geht es in Deinem Job?

I do erotic films and the company is mine. I created the company in 2004 so it is turning 10 years now. At my office I do of course check all my emails, I check the numbers on my sites online because I have a few different online properties, I few different websites that I am running. One is xconfessions.com, that is my latest project where people are sending in their confessions, their erotic confessions. Then I have another site called lustcinema.com where I gather a lot of different films from this new wave of adult cinema from different creators and directors and then I have an online store called Erik Lust store. Well, when I create a film it all starts with an idea, of course. For me the ideas are very important because it is the basic thing that we are working out from. So I sit down and I think about what should I do and then it is the creative script write process where, we are throwing ideas, you know we are looking at how should we really create this film, who are the main characters, why are they meeting, in what circumstances, in what locations. And then the process goes on and the other people in my production team comes in. I also of course do castings in my job because I need actors for my films. In the casting process I look for people that are different, that have a special personality, that are sex positive, that love being in front of the camera. I look for people that doesn’t look like they are typical porn stars.

Wie sieht Dein Werdegang aus?

So my background, I am Swedish from Stockholm. I studied Political Science and Gender Studies and then years after university I moved down to Barcelona where my life changed. I was working in the audiovisual industry as a production manager for quite many years and a location manager. And then I created my own company in 2004 and at the beginning it was just a very small company and I was making a film every two years and I was still working as a freelancer for other companies. But since 2008 more or less I can live on my own company and that’s something that I am very, very proud of really.

Ginge es auch ohne Deinem Werdegang?

In terms of film production I think that I am from a generation that really grew up with such level of audiovisual quality that we all have this audiovisual mind kind of. But then of course if you want to work in the film industry get some education as always, learn how it, how the process really works, how are you making a movie. But also I think it is very important to learn more about the business side of it because I have the feeling that many people that want to work in film they are creative people and they know a lot about the shooting process, about the camera, they know about the script writing and they have many, many ideas but they have absolutely no clue how to make a business out of those ideas. So I would recommend you to get some business studies.
